Distance & flight times: Phoenix Sky Harbor International to Eglin Afb

The shortest flight time between PHX and VPS is 5 hours and 49 minutes.

ViaTotal flight timeLayover timeDistance
DFW Dallas5h 49m1h 25m1513 miles (2434 km)
DAL Dallas6h 10m1h 40m1514 miles (2436 km)
BNA Nashville6h 28m1h 15m1845 miles (2969 km)
HOU Houston6h 35m1h 35m1552 miles (2497 km)
STL Saint Louis6h 40m45m1880 miles (3025 km)
ABQ Albuquerque6h 45m1h 30m1541 miles (2479 km)
ATL Atlanta7h 1m2h 48m1843 miles (2965 km)
AUS Austin8h 5m1h 45m1543 miles (2483 km)
MCI Kansas City8h 20m1h 45m1816 miles (2922 km)
The flight times and layover times in the table above are approximate and may vary depending on flight number, aircraft, airline, weather, and time of day.PHX-VPS flight routesPhoenix to Fort Walton Beach flight routes illustrated on a map.

A codeshare agreement means that cooperating airlines are able to sell seats on each other’s flights. This means that you are able to travel to more destinations than your airline of choice normally offers. Codeshare flights are also beneficial because of the seamless transits you can get with connecting flights from the same airline. The downside of choosing a codeshare flight can be that you in some cases can’t upgrade codeshare flights or use elite benefits.

A connecting or transit flight means that you reach your final destination through two or more flights – in other words a non-direct flight. You will change to a new aircraft after your first flight, this may include moving to another terminal at the airport aswell. The time required to transfer passengers and luggage between flights is called Minimum Connecting Time (MCT) and are always taken into account here on Flightroutes.com.

If you bought your whole flight on a single ticket, the airline will book you on the next available connecting flight.

With connecting flights, checked in luggage is most commonly forwarded to your final destination when buying a single ticket for both flights.

If you miss your connecting flight due to circumstances outside your control such as your first flight being delayed, you should turn to your airline who will provide you with a seat on the next available flight. This is usually done free of charge, and only applies if you purchased your trip as one ticket. If the next connecting flight is the following day, the airline usually provides accommodation and meals.
